【问题标题】:Grails 3 set remote debug ip:portGrails 3 设置远程调试 ip:port
【发布时间】:2015-10-12 12:58:51
【问题描述】:

我想远程调试 grails 3 应用程序。但是我没有找到如何更改隐式调试器端口。有没有办法做类似grails run-app --jvm-debug --debugger-port=9999 --debugger-addr=10.0.50.55 的事情?

【问题讨论】:

    标签: debugging grails grails-3.0


    【解决方案1】:

    您可以通过直接启动位于grails-app/init 中的Application 类来运行您的grails 应用程序。它有一个static void main 并作为常规应用程序运行。您可以使用您选择的调试配置文件从 IDE 运行它。

    【讨论】:

      【解决方案2】:

      将此添加到您的 build.gradle 并通过您想要的端口修改 5005:

      bootRun {
          addResources = false // We can set it to true if we would like to reload src/main/resources
          jvmArgs = ["-Xdebug", "-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=5005"]
      }
      

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 2018-05-06
        • 2013-07-08
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2015-07-01
        • 2011-05-13
        • 1970-01-01
        相关资源
        最近更新 更多